Abstract (AB)Increase of sucrose content following Polaris application were similar when determined by polarimetric and gas liquid chromatography analytical methods. The results showed that increases of pol per cent cane represented true increases of sucrose. Treatment with the ripener also lowered the levels of both glucose and fructose. Increases in sucrose content were however, influenced to a greater extent by the geographical sector of the island than by soil type. Flowered and vegetative stalks responded equally well when Polaris was applied during the flag stage of the high flowering variety S17. Rain up to 5 mm during or just after spraying reduced response. The parameters which must be used to determine the optimum dosage for Polaris treatment are cost of Polaris and its application; its effect on sucrose content; yield after application and yield for regrowth crop.
